Here are the readings for Sunday, November 16, 2025 (33rd Sunday in Ordinary Time):

  • First Reading – Malachi 3:19–20a “Lo, the day is coming, blazing like an oven, when all the proud and all evildoers will be stubble… But for you who fear my name, there will arise the sun of justice with its healing rays.” → A vivid apocalyptic image of fire and renewal, paired with hope in the “sun of justice.”

  • Responsorial Psalm – Psalm 98:5–9 “The Lord comes to rule the earth with justice.” → Joyful music, trumpets, rivers clapping their hands, seas resounding—creation itself rejoices at God’s justice.

  • Second Reading – 2 Thessalonians 3:7–12 Paul reminds the community to imitate his example of hard work and not idleness. → A call to live faithfully and responsibly, avoiding disorder and laziness.

  • Gospel – Luke 21:5–19 Jesus foretells the destruction of the temple and warns of trials, persecution, and endurance. “By your perseverance you will secure your lives.” → A powerful theme of resilience and trust in God amid chaos.
